MHS boasts new Science Teacher of the Year

May 25th, 2006

Gloria D’Agostino has received the Science Teacher of the Year Award in Chemistry from the Southeast Section of the Science Teachers Association of New York State. The award will be given at the Association’s Awards dinner on May 26, 2006. Gloria has been teaching chemistry at MHS for 24 years. She will do anything from standing on her head to working after school with individual students to help her students be successful in chemistry. One of most important goals in her teaching is for the students to leave her classroom with an appreciation of science. She is also an important part of the Middletown High School community. She has served on various curriculum committees, has been a union representative, and is currently on the Executive Board of the Middletown Teacher Center. When asked about the award, she said “I am not sure if I deserve it, but it was a nice surprise at the end of a hard year.” All of her colleagues and her past and current students know she truly deserves the award!
